Enhance Posted August 10, 2017 Share Posted August 10, 2017 From the Fall News thread. Sam McKewon's take on POB from Aug. 4th. Pay particular attention to the bolded. Quarterbacks: Lee has been excellent. Patrick O’Brien has to keep his footwork and mechanics tight; I saw a few tosses off his back foot, which made the ball sail. My read: O’Brien is perhaps a hair off his precision from late in the spring. Tristan Gebbia has savvy and, because he’s pretty slight, some athleticism outside the pocket that’s interesting. Gebbia puts his whole body into throwing deep out and corner routes. Andrew Bunch, an emergency quarterback, looks more than capable of throwing a pass in case someone loses his helmet.
